The loan signing of Spurs defender Chris Gunter is confirmed today and he has told the official site, that former Red Michael Dawson helped him decide on a move to the City Ground.
Dawson left the Reds', back in 2005 along with midfielder Andy Reid in a combined fee thought to be around £8M (where did that go? KERCHING!). Dawson has been a regular fixture in the Spurs backline since then, although Reid has had several clubs since he left Trentside, for White Hart Lane. Both players probably regret leaving us for the Prem and sunnier climbs, but some people just aren't cut out for three years in League 1 and lower league football.
Gunter had apparently got several offers on the table, but after chatting to Dawson his mind was made up. 'I spoke to Michael and he only had good things to say about the club. Michael just backed up my decision and I'm delighted to be here.' Makes you wonder how much of a friend Daws is, with advice like that.
Well, we're glad to have you Chris and there's no denying you'll be needed. One thing is certain and that's the fact he'll get games. With a growing injury list, he isn't exactly going to be fighting for a place. That's what he's been sent here for, as he's finding it hard to break into the first team at the Lane. Hopefully this will be a move that keeps all parties happy. We get a decent defender, he gets the experience of regular first team football and Forest get to stay in the Championship. Job's a good 'un. If only it were that simple.
